Shocking footage has emerged of a horror machete attack in north Dublin that left a teenager with serious injuries - as a local councillor condemns those involved saying they have a “blatant disregard for the public.”

The horror incident happened around lunchtime on Tuesday, July 2 in Poppintree Parade, Ballymun when two males on a scrambler bike armed with a large machete and baseball bat attacked another male at a shop.

CCTV footage of the shocking incident from inside the shop shows the victim falling onto the ground inside the front door as a security guard tries to protect him.

Both the victim and security guard fall to the ground but the security guard manages to get back on his feet to prevent one of the males armed with a machete from entering the shop.

The security guard quickly closes the shop door and pulls down the shutters as the two armed males remain outside.

A still from a CCTV camera outside the shop shows the two culprits - one sitting on a scrambler bike holding a baseball bat while the second male stands behind the bike brandishing the large machete knife.

Local councillor Keith Connolly expressed his shock and horror at the incident saying those involved have a “blatant disregard for the public.”

Cllr Connolly said: “There has been an issue for some time around that area of intimidation and open drug dealing and this has been raised at the Joint Policing Committee for a number of years now.

“What happened on Tuesday is shocking. Locals are in complete shock. It’s a busy area and for this to happen at lunchtime when kids are off school is absolutely shocking.

“Those involved have a blatant disregard for the public and it was very traumatic for those who witnessed it in an area that should be safe. More resources need to be pumped into the area,” he said.

One eyewitness is heard saying on a video of the aftermath of the scene “I am after seeing the whole lot of it there. Two lads on a scrambler, two machetes in each hand jumped off and tried to take yer man’s head off. Yer man on the front of the bike had a big baseball bat too. They tried to do harm to him. I am not joking. He must be in bits. Fair play to the security guard, shoved the lads off and banged the shutter down.”

An ambulance and several squad cars arrived at the scene within minutes and tended to the injured male before taking him to the Mater Hospital for treatment.

Local councillor Conor Reddy also condemned the terrifying attack and warned “Someone will be killed.”

“It’s terrifying and adds to the sense of fear in the area. It’s not an isolated incident in the area. There were shots fired last week and an assault.

“Someone will be killed,” he warned.

“Kids witnessed this incident and it is traumatising for them and anyone else who saw it happen,” he said, adding that the Government needs to get involved to stop the gangs and violence the area is experiencing and to “pull people out of the cycle of crime, violence and drugs.”

“Youth workers are doing unquantifiable work but they need to be funded permanently.”

So far, no arrests have been made but gardai confirmed investigations are ongoing.

In astatement, An Garda Siochana said: “Gardai attended the scene of an assault on Tuesday, July 2 at approximately 1pm in Poppintree Parade, Ballymun.

“One man, aged in his late teens, was seriously injured and taken to Mater Hospital for treatment.

“Investigations ongoing.”
